Mini Tummy Tuck & liposuction

Dr. Daws has adopted a revolutionary minimally invasive approach to tummy tuck that can be safely and effectively performed as an office procedure totally under local tumescent anesthesia. This technique combines two procedures: liposuction of the abdomen and tummy tuck. By avoiding the use of general anesthesia or heavy sedation (and complications associated with this type of anesthesia), this new procedure offers an improved postoperative recovery.

Mesotherapy or Lipo-Dissolve

Mesotherapy treatments employ the technique of multiple micro injections of pharmaceutical and homeopathic medications, standardized natural plant extracts and vitamins into the mesoderm. Mesotherapy injections target adipose fat cells, rejuvenates collagen, and stimulates new hyaluronic acid support of the mesoderm extracellular matrix (ECM).

Mesotherapy is popular in the United States and one of the most requested non-surgical cosmetic procedures for cellulite treatment, liposculpting and body contouring. Physicians specializing in non-surgical cosmetic medicine or operating medical spas are the most common practitioners.

Dr. Michel Pistor (1924-2003) performed clinical research and founded the field of mesotherapy. Multi-national research in intradermal therapy culminated with Pistor's work from 1948 to 1952 in human mesotherapy treatments. The French press coined the term mesotherapy in 1958. The French Academy of Medicine recognized Mesotherapy as a Specialty of Medicine in 1987. Popular throughout European countries and South America, mesotherapy is practiced by approximately 18,000 physicians worldwide. Popularized in the United States during the late 1990's, Mesotherapy is now the fastest growing aesthetic medicine specialty.

This treatment involves the injection of small doses of medication directly into unwanted areas of fat, including bags under the eyes, saddlebags, love handles and cellulite. This process works best in combination with a weight management program and proper nutrition.
